Iranian intelligence has issued a statement alleging that hostile forces are employing 'soft warfare' and other hybrid tactics to pressure the country. According to the statement, these tactics include economic pressure, inciting public opinion through social issues, provoking ethnic and religious conflicts, and conducting cyberattacks. Additionally, the statement claims that attempts to launch ground operations from western and northwestern Iran were thwarted by Iranian forces. The statement also accuses foreign media of participating in information warfare and reports the seizure of weapons and communication equipment by Iranian intelligence. Despite these challenges, the intelligence department asserts that Iran has maintained stability through various security threats, including wars and failed coups.
